'lakeside Zinger', if not classified as a mini, is very small. It's a fast growing mound of dark green leaves with wide white margins. Flecks of green appear in white margins. I've had mine since 2006. It forms a dense mound - good ground-cover. Mine was attacked more than usual by slugs in 2015. Please feel free to share your pictures of this hosta.
